site stats

Git not tracking renamed file

WebJan 4, 2024 · commit 1 : add b.txt this is not the same commit, just same change. commit 2 : move b.txt to myfolder/b.txt it show renamed file in git ui. my feature folder view: myfolder/b.txt. When I in master, I do. git merge feature. I thought I can get this: my master folder view after merge: myfolder/b.txt. Web101. One branch ( refactoringBranch) had a complete directory restructure. Files were moved chaosly, but the content was preserved. I tried to merge: git merge --no-ff -Xrename-threshold=15 -Xpatience -Xignore-space-change refactoringBranch. git status shows …

git extension to explicitly track file renames? - Stack Overflow

WebFeb 22, 2013 · Why Git Thinks Your Files Are Copies. Git tracks content, not filenames. As a result, if two files have substantially similar content, git will think you copied or renamed the file. If you read git-log(1), you will learn: The similarity index is the percentage of unchanged lines, and the dissimilarity index is the percentage of changed lines. WebOct 29, 2011 · Git tracks file contents, not filenames. So renaming a file without changing its content is easy for git to detect. (Git does not track, but performs detection; using git mv or git rm and git add is effectively the same.). When a file is added to the repository, the filename is in the tree object. health projects for high school https://harringtonconsultinggroup.com

Why isn

WebJan 15, 2013 · GIT not tracking files. I have setup GIT on AIX 6.1 and am facing problems. I create a folder. Create a file named index.html with some data in the file. Go into the newly created folder. Create a new file named index-2.html with some data in it. After performing all the steps above and give the git status command I'm getting the foll result: WebApr 21, 2011 · I'm relatively new to Git. I used Subversion (SVN) before. I noticed that most of the graphical Git front-ends and IDE plugins don't seem to be able to display the history of a file if the file has been renamed. When I use. git log --follow. on the command line, I can see the whole log across renames. Web21. Git doesn't actually track renames in the repository, it uses a diff heuristic to determine if you renamed a file to another. That is to say, if you git mv a file and then replace the contents completely, it is not considered a rename, and you do not need to use git mv for it to detect renames. For example: good earth promoters

Getting Git to follow renamed and edited files - Stack Overflow

Category:Using quick fix action to rename an identifier does not rename ...

Tags:Git not tracking renamed file

Git not tracking renamed file

GitHub - michael/editable-website: A SvelteKit template for …

WebJun 14, 2024 · Creating an Initial Repository 21 Adding a File to Your Repository 22 Configuring the Commit Author 24 Making Another Commit 24 Viewing Your Commits 25 Viewing Commit Differences 26 Removing and Renaming Files in Your Repository 26 Making a Copy of Your Repository ... Conflicted Files 129 Inspecting Conflicts 129 How … WebJan 23, 2024 · 2. There are plenty ways, depending on what exactly you want to see. e. g. git show --name-status --diff-filter=ACDR will show you added, copied, deleted and renamed files of the given commit-ish, including commit metadata like message. For only the list of files, you can do git diff ^! --name-status - …

Git not tracking renamed file

Did you know?

WebFeb 12, 2013 · In my opinion, the decision not to track renames is based on the faulty assumption that it's the content that matters, not the name. I disagree. Let me give you a real-world example. I had a class RefinementPresentation which was used as a model in the view template of a web page. I move the class to a separate package (model) and then, … WebTo make things a bit easier this is what I do: Move all affected files outside of the directory to, let’s say, the desktop. Do a git add . -A to stage the removal of those files. Rename all files on the desktop to the proper capitalization. Move all the files back to the original directory. Do a git add ..

WebApr 4, 2024 · These are needed to run the example as is, but you can choose any other database and file storage solution. Step 1 - Development setup. This is a full-fledged web app you want adjust to your own needs. So please create a copy or fork of the source code and rename the project accordingly. Then check out your own copy: WebThere are 3 options; you probably want #3. This will keep the local file for you, but will delete it for anyone else when they pull. git rm --cached or git rm -r --cached . This is for optimization, like a folder with a large number of files, e.g. SDKs that probably won't ever change.

WebJun 8, 2013 · This answer was the only that helped fixing my issue. Not sure if that's a Windows thing (I have never had any problems like this in the past, either in osx or linux). So thanks to @ThorSummoner. Btw, I tried git add -f the file that was in this "assume unchanged" state, and it did not work - had to either git update-index or git rm --cached … WebNov 30, 2024 · Git has no file history at all. Git has only commits. Each commit stores a complete snapshot of a source tree. Each commit also has some number of parent commits, usually just one. This is much more like traditional commit-based VCSes: one can trace through the various commits, or look at file history. But since Git doesn't have file history ...

WebNov 13, 2024 · In your Git working directory, you wish to rename a previously committed file named mycoolclass.cs to myCoolClass.cs and commit the newly renamed file. Solution. Solution. 1. Change to the directory containing your repository: for example, cd /Repo/MyProject/. 2. Run the following git command: git mv mycoolclass.cs …

WebJun 28, 2024 · 3. If you have a directory named Assets and you want to rename it to assets, run git mv Assets assets, and then commit that change. That will tell Git that you want the files in the directory renamed, since on a case-insensitive system, Git has no way of knowing that you've changed the case unless you tell it. health projects centerWebJan 27, 2012 · The solution is: renaming the folders. Try switching the folder name to something else. Commit that, then rename it back. If the subfolder itself is another Git repo, and you want it to be totally detached from the mainstream, and follow your repo, you should remove the remote of that subfolder first. Share. good earth reflexologyWebFeb 2, 2024 · The short answer is "you can't". In particular, Git doesn't track folders at all, only files, and it then does rename detection on the files.You can completely disable rename detection in git status output in Git since 2.18, though. This may suffice, in some limited cases, to get you close enough to what you want, perhaps also using --skip … health projects for high school studentsWebApr 5, 2024 · 0. Finally going to give up and ask for help. Having some git (windows) issues. If I make changes to an existing file,I can add-commit-push as usual. However, if I create … health projects in the philippinesgood earth replacement motion sensorWebJan 11, 2009 · Just git add the new file, and git rm the old file. git status will then show whether it has detected the rename. additionally, for moves around directories, you may need to: cd to the top of that directory structure. Run git add -A . Run git status to verify that the "new file" is now a "renamed" file. If git status still shows "new file" and ... good earth red teaWebFeb 20, 2024 · Perform the following to record the rename operation in the staging area. Stage the deleted file− “file1.txt” and. Stage the untracked file− “file1.java”. Use the git add command to achieve this. $ git add file1.txt $ git add file1.java. Use the git status command to verify the status. $ git status. good earth rechargeable under counter lights